Retitling. I think being able to configure run tests when /trunk/phase3 or
/trunk/extensions changes or any other set of paths would be nice. It's true,
running parser tests when somebody updated their USERINFO or something in
/trunk/tools

However, I agree with Bryan that we shouldn't make a billion special cases, so
I think this should be very general. Don't need to say unless only X Y or Z
changed, then skip it

In any case, I removed our crappy test system in r69385 (which had been broken
forever). Marking this LATER, for revival one day once someone puts a new test
system into Code Review.
